数据分析是现代商业和科学研究中的重要工具,它可以帮助我们从大量数据中提取有价值的信息。叉心计算(Cross-Tabulation)是数据分析中的一种基本技术,它通过创建交叉表来展示两个或多个变量之间的关系。本文将详细介绍叉心计算的概念、应用场景以及如何轻松掌握这一数据分析的秘诀。
一、什么是叉心计算?
叉心计算,也称为交叉表分析,是一种用于展示两个或多个变量之间关系的方法。它通过将一个变量的不同类别与另一个变量的不同类别进行交叉,从而生成一个二维表格,即交叉表。交叉表可以直观地展示不同类别组合之间的频数、百分比等统计量。
二、叉心计算的应用场景
- 市场分析:分析不同产品、不同地区、不同时间段的销售情况。
- 用户分析:分析不同用户群体在网站上的行为、购买偏好等。
- 风险评估:分析不同风险因素对投资回报的影响。
- 医疗研究:分析不同疾病在不同人群中的发病率、死亡率等。
三、如何进行叉心计算?
以下是进行叉心计算的基本步骤:
1. 数据准备
首先,确保你拥有清晰、准确的数据集。数据可以是结构化的,如Excel表格,也可以是非结构化的,如文本、图片等。
2. 选择变量
确定你想要分析的变量。例如,在市场分析中,你可能想分析“产品类型”和“销售区域”之间的关系。
3. 创建交叉表
使用Excel、Python等工具创建交叉表。以下是一个使用Python进行交叉计算的例子:
import pandas as pd
# 创建示例数据
data = {'产品类型': ['A', 'B', 'C', 'A', 'B', 'C'],
'销售区域': ['东', '西', '南', '东', '西', '南'],
'销售额': [100, 150, 200, 120, 180, 160]}
# 创建DataFrame
df = pd.DataFrame(data)
# 创建交叉表
cross_table = pd.crosstab(df['产品类型'], df['销售区域'], values=df['销售额'], aggfunc='sum', margins=True)
print(cross_table)
4. 分析结果
分析交叉表中的数据,了解不同变量之间的关系。例如,在上面的例子中,我们可以看到产品类型A在东、西、南三个区域的销售额分别为100、120、0,而在产品类型B和C的情况下,销售额也呈现出类似的分布。
四、轻松掌握叉心计算的秘诀
- 熟悉工具:掌握Excel、Python等数据分析工具,熟练运用交叉表功能。
- 数据清洗:确保数据准确、完整,避免因数据质量问题导致分析结果偏差。
- 合理选择变量:选择具有代表性的变量,避免变量过多导致分析结果复杂化。
- 可视化:使用图表、图形等可视化工具展示分析结果,提高可读性。
通过以上方法,你可以轻松掌握叉心计算,将其应用于实际数据分析中,为你的工作和研究提供有力支持。
